How they compare
Canada currently reports -0.879 against -0.923 in Mali, a difference of 0.044.
The two have swapped places 10 times across 30 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Canada ahead.
Canada ranks 116th and Mali ranks 118th of 188 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Canada averaged higher in 3 and Mali in 1.
